A trailer hitch step, integrally molded of a polymer compound, is capable of accepting a predetermined off-axis vertical load without an objectionable degree of torsional displacement, while also being capable of resiliently absorbing energy from rear impacts.

1. A hitch step adapted for insertion into a hollow vehicle hitch receiver along a longitudinal axis, the hitch step comprising: a tongue having a rear end, the tongue having a vertical height and a width transverse to the axis, the height and width of the tongue being sized such that the tongue may be closely slidably received into the vehicle hitch receiver;a throat region of the tongue formed to adjoin the step body, a forward region of the tongue extending forwardly from the throat region, at least one hitch pin hole formed in the forward region to extend transversely therethrough;the throat region having at least one open external face parallel to the axis, a throat region volume extending vertically from the open face and extending to either an opposed face of the throat region or to a panel, a plurality of vertically disposed reinforcing plates of the throat region extending vertically from the open face and dividing all of the throat region volume into substantially triangularly prismatic cells; anda step body joined to the rear end of the tongue and in use solely supported in cantilever fashion by the tongue, the step body having a rear face, a front face, a left end and a right end, a top surface of the step body extending from the front face to the rear face and from the left end to the right end, the top surface having a width transverse to the axis which is many times the width of the tongue, the top surface adapted to receive a foot of a user at least at a predetermined location displaced from the axis in a width direction, the reinforcing plates of the throat region being so disposed to resist torque around the axis caused by the weight of the user imposed on said location, the tongue and the step body being integrally molded of a polymer compound. 2. The hitch step of claim 1, wherein the plates include a vertical member aligned with the axis. 3. The hitch step of claim 1, wherein the plates include a plate oriented transversely to the axis. 4. The hitch step of claim 1, wherein the rear end of the tongue is joined to the front face of the step body throughout the width and height of the tongue. 5. The hitch step of claim 1, wherein when the tongue of the hitch step is inserted into a hitch receiver and a 250 pound load is placed on a top surface of the step body at a location transversely displaced from the axis by 4 inches, the step body will deflect in a transverse vertical plane by no more than ten degrees. 6. The hitch step of claim 5, wherein when the tongue of the hitch step is inserted into a hitch receiver and a 265 pound load is placed on a top surface of the step body at a location transversely displaced from the axis by 4 inches, the step body will deflect in a transverse vertical plane by no more than eight degrees. 7. A hitch step for insertion into a hollow vehicle hitch receiver, the hitch step comprising: a substantially hollow step body having a height, a width transverse to an axis of the vehicle hitch receiver and a depth in parallel to the axis, at least one transverse support member inside the step body having a thickness that is many times less that the depth of the step body, the transverse member transversely extending for at least a substantial portion of the step body and extending in a vertical direction for at least a substantial portion of the height of the step body, at least one external face of the step body in parallel to the axis being open;a substantially hollow tongue having a rear end joined to the step body and a front end axially displaced from the rear end, the tongue sized to be slidably received into the vehicle hitch receiver and in use providing the sole support for the step body, the tongue having a height and a width transverse to the axis, the width of the tongue being many times less than the width of the step body;a throat region of the tongue adjoining the step body and extending forwardly from the step body along the axis, at least one external face of the throat region being in parallel to the axis and being open, a plurality of vertically disposed reinforcing plates of the throat region extending from the open face to either a horizontal panel or to an opposed external face of the throat region; anda forward region of the tongue extending forwardly from the throat region of the tongue, the forward region having at least one external face parallel to the axis which is open and a vertical plate disposed in parallel to the axis, the vertical plate having a thickness in a transverse direction that is many times less than the width of the tongue, a height of the vertical plate extending for at least a substantial portion of the height of the tongue, at least one trailer hitch pin hole formed to transversely extend through the vertical plate;wherein the step body and the tongue are integrally molded of a polymeric material. 8. The hitch step of claim 7, wherein the step body has a plurality of transverse members including said at least one transverse member, the transverse members being axially spaced apart from each other by a distance at least as great as the thickness of the transverse members. 9. The hitch step of claim 7, wherein the step body has a top panel joined to said at least one transverse member and extending substantially for the entire width and depth of the step body, a thickness of the top panel in the vertical direction being many times less than the height of the step body. 10. The hitch step of claim 7, wherein the vertical plate of the forward region of the tongue is positioned on the axis and axially rearwardly extends through the throat region and into the step body for a substantial portion of the depth of the step body. 11. The hitch step of claim 7, wherein said at least one transverse support member of the step body is one of a plurality of internal support members. 12. The hitch step of claim 11, wherein ones of the internal support members intersect each other and divide the volume of the step body into a plurality of cells. 13. The hitch step of claim 12, wherein the cells are substantially prismatic. 14. The hitch step of claim 7, wherein the polymer compound exhibits a flexural modulus, as tested according to ISO 178, of at least 550 MPa at 23 C.
